The prople of Lout (Lot) (those dwelt in the towns of Sodom in Palestine) belied the Messengers. 160 Behold, their brother Lut said to them: "Will ye not fear (Allah)? 161 I am a trustworthy Messenger. 162 "So fear Allah and obey me. 163 And I ask of you no wage therefor; my wage is the concern only of the Lord of the Worlds. 164 "Of all the creatures in the world, will ye approach males, 165 keeping yourselves aloof from all the [lawful] spouses whom your Sustainer has created for you? Nay, but you are people who transgress all bounds of what is right!" 166 They said: "If you cease not. O Lout (Lot)! Verily, you will be one of those who are driven out!" 167 He said: I am in truth of those who hate your conduct. 168 (And prayed:) "O Lord, save me and my family from what they do." 169 So We delivered him and his followers all, 170 Except an old woman, among those who remained behind. 171 Thereafter We annihilated the rest. 172 by pouring upon them a terrible shower of rain. How evil was the rain for those who had been warned! 173 Verily in this was a sign, but most of them do not believe. 174 And lo! thy Lord, He is indeed the Mighty, the Merciful. 175
